《微机原理与接口技术》是一门深入探讨计算机硬件与软件交互的重要课程,它涉及到计算机系统的基础构造和工作原理。周杰英教授的PPT教材是针对这门课程精心制作的教学资源,旨在帮助学生全面理解和掌握微机系统的核心概念。
在PPT中,"05 微处理器总线与时序.pdf"涵盖了微处理器内部总线结构和时序控制的基本概念。总线是微处理器与其他组件通信的桥梁,而时序控制则是确保数据正确传输的关键。这部分会讲解到地址总线、数据总线和控制总线的作用,以及时钟信号如何协调微处理器的工作。
"13 Pentium微处理器.pdf"聚焦于英特尔的Pentium系列处理器,这是个人计算机领域广泛应用的一类处理器。内容可能包括Pentium的架构特点、超标量处理、多级缓存系统等,帮助学生理解高性能处理器的工作机制。
"03 80x86指令系统.pdf"详细解析了80x86系列微处理器的指令集,这是理解x86架构的基础。涵盖的指令可能包括数据处理、转移控制、输入输出等,这些指令在汇编语言编程中至关重要。
"12 模_数、数_模接口技术与编程.pdf"介绍了模拟和数字信号之间的转换,包括A/D和D/A转换器的原理和应用,以及如何通过编程控制这些接口。
"04 汇编语言程序设计.pdf"深入探讨了汇编语言,这是一种低级编程语言,直接对应机器指令。学生将学习如何编写、调试和优化汇编代码,这对于理解计算机底层工作和性能优化至关重要。
"06 存储器.pdf"涵盖了存储器层次结构,包括寄存器、高速缓存、主存和磁盘存储等。这部分会讲解存储器的工作原理、访问速度和容量,以及如何进行有效的存储管理。
"11 串行通信及接口电路.pdf"涉及串行通信协议,如UART、SPI和I2C,以及相应的接口电路设计。这部分内容对于实现设备间的远程通信和嵌入式系统设计非常重要。
"09 计数器和定时器电路.pdf"讨论了计数器和定时器的原理和应用,它们在数字系统中起到定时、计数和脉冲发生等功能。
"10 8255.pdf"专门讲解了8255可编程并行接口芯片,它是微机接口技术中的经典案例,用于实现CPU与其他设备的数据交换。
"08 中断.pdf"介绍了中断的概念和处理机制,中断是计算机系统中一种异步通信方式,能够及时响应外部事件。
通过学习这套PPT资料,学生不仅能掌握微机系统的硬件基础,还能了解软件与硬件交互的关键技术,为未来在计算机科学和相关领域的工作打下坚实基础。利用碎片时间深入学习,将有助于提升理论知识和实践能力。